Block
#13,421,919
5w
7 txs164,792 confs
Transactions
7
Total Output
₳840,225.4
$127.47K
Fees
₳2.1
Size
13.55 KB
13,875 bytes
Details
Hash
3bc108fc4d862a7839fcdb4e4eb412e26071f481716955eee6499d329ee03edc
Epoch / Slot
Epoch 631 · slot 187,289,558 · epoch-slot 60,758
Timestamp
5w · Fri, 15 May 2026 14:37:29 GMT
Block producer
VRF key
vrf_vk12…gq37n0fg
Op cert
2b2dfbc9…6f7f5961
Op cert counter
31